Esophagitis refers to the inflammation that occurs within the esophagus, the muscular tube responsible for transporting food from the mouth to the stomach. This condition can develop due to various reasons, including infections, allergic reactions, medication effects, and acid reflux. Understanding the different types of esophagitis, their underlying causes, symptoms, and treatment options is essential for effective management and prevention of possible complications. Many cases of esophagitis are linked to infectious agents that can invade the esophageal lining through various routes such as the throat, mouth, or stomach, especially in individuals with compromised immune systems. Those who have pre-existing conditions like cancer, diabetes, or HIV infection are particularly vulnerable. Common infectious causes include fungi like Candida species, viruses such as herpes simplex virus or cytomegalovirus, and molds like aspergillosis and mucormycosis. These pathogens can cause severe inflammation and damage if not promptly diagnosed and treated. **Infectious Esophagitis**: Infections represent a significant subset of esophageal inflammation, predominantly affecting immunocompromised patients. Fungal infections, especially candidiasis, are among the most prevalent, often presenting with white plaques or patches inside the esophagus. Viral infections like herpes simplex virus can cause painful ulcers, while cytomegalovirus may lead to large, deep lesions that impair swallowing. Mucormycosis and aspergillosis are rare but serious fungal infections often seen in severely immunosuppressed individuals, capable of causing extensive tissue necrosis. **Eosinophilic Esophagitis**: This allergic-type inflammation involves an accumulation of eosinophils – a specific white blood cell type – within the esophageal tissue. Eosinophilic esophagitis (EoE) is frequently linked to allergies and hypersensitive reactions to certain foods and environmental allergens. Patients may experience difficulty swallowing, food impaction, chest discomfort, or persistent heartburn. Common dietary triggers include allergenic foods such as nuts, dairy products, soy, wheat, and eggs. Environmental factors like pollen can also provoke eosinophilic responses, contributing to esophageal inflammation. **Drug-Induced Esophagitis**: Certain medications can damage the esophageal lining if not taken properly. Medications like pain relievers (NSAIDs), antibiotics, bisphosphonates (used for osteoporosis), and others can cause local irritation, ulcers, or strictures when they linger in the esophagus. This often results from inadequate water intake or taking pills immediately before lying down. Patients might experience sore throat, chest pain, difficulty swallowing, or erosions visible on endoscopy. Proper medication administration techniques can significantly reduce the risk of drug-induced esophagitis. **Reflux Esophagitis (Gastroesophageal Reflux Disease - GERD)**: One of the most common causes of esophagitis worldwide, reflux esophagitis develops when stomach acids and partially digested food flow backward into the esophagus. This acid exposure leads to inflammation, erosions, and sometimes ulcers within the esophageal lining. Chronic GERD can result in complications such as strictures, Barrett’s esophagus, or even esophageal cancer if untreated. Symptoms include heartburn, regurgitation, chest pain, and difficulty swallowing. **Diagnosis and Treatment Options**: Accurate diagnosis involves a combination of patient history, physical examination, endoscopy, biopsy, and pH monitoring. Treatment strategies vary depending on the type and severity of esophagitis. Common interventions include over-the-counter remedies like antacids, prescription medications such as proton pump inhibitors or H2 blockers, corticosteroids for allergic eosinophilic esophagitis, antifungal or antiviral drugs for infections, and lifestyle modifications like diet changes and weight management. In severe cases, surgical options might be considered, especially if complication rates are high or if conservative treatments fail. Dietary recommendations often emphasize avoiding trigger foods, reducing alcohol consumption, quitting smoking, and elevating the head of the bed to prevent nighttime reflux. Lifestyle adjustments play a crucial role in managing chronic esophagitis and preserving esophageal function. **Potential Consequences of Untreated Esophagitis**: If inflammation of the esophagus persists without intervention, it can lead to irreversible damage. Chronic inflammation can cause the development of esophageal ulcers, narrowing (strictures), or even precancerous changes like Barrett’s esophagus. Prompt diagnosis and tailored treatment are essential to prevent these serious outcomes and ensure a good quality of life for affected individuals.
